Municipality of El Calvario, Meta, free from suspicion of explosive devices

cogfm-ejercito-brigada-desminado-humanitario-el-calvario-meta-14.jpg

The municipality of El Calvario, located in the Paramo area of the central mountain range, and with a population of 1,700 inhabitants, is today part of the new 12 territories declared free of suspicion of contamination by anti-personnel mines.

 

In the area that has had four Military Forces victims due to anti-personnel mines, soldiers from the Humanitarian Demining Engineers Battalion No.4 of the National Army, through humanitarian demining tasks, achieved to demined 3.948 m2.

 

Now more than 450 people of the rural sector who are dedicated to the growing of blackberry, squid, corn, tomato, bean, cane and dairy production, will be able to carry out their activities with security and confidence.

 

According to Wilson Alf茅rez, the municipal Mayor, the increase in productivity in the agricultural sector would be 40 percent and in the livestock sector 30 percent, due to the reliability of the land without anti-personnel mines.

 

With this municipality, nine villages are now free from anti-personnel mines in this department.
